Porch slab repair services focus on restoring the stability and appearance of concrete slabs that form the foundation of a porch or entryway. Over time, exposure to the elements and regular use can cause these slabs to develop cracks, uneven surfaces, or sinking areas. Repairing these issues involves removing damaged sections, filling cracks, and leveling the surface to ensure a safe and attractive entrance. Skilled service providers use specialized techniques and materials to reinforce the slab and prevent future problems, helping homeowners maintain a welcoming and functional porch area.

Many porch slab problems stem from common issues such as soil shifting, poor initial installation, or water infiltration. Cracks and settling can create tripping hazards or lead to further deterioration if not addressed promptly. Repair services often involve injecting concrete or foam to lift sinking slabs, patching cracks to prevent water from seeping underneath, and ensuring proper drainage around the porch. These repairs not only enhance safety but also extend the lifespan of the porch, saving homeowners from more costly replacements down the line.

The overview below groups typical Porch Slab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Auburn, AL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Most minor porch slab repairs in Auburn typically cost between $250 and $600. These projects often involve patching small cracks or replacing a few broken sections and are common for routine maintenance. Local contractors usually handle these straightforward jobs efficiently within this range.

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s, such as replacing larger sections or addressing significant cracking, generally fall between $600 and $1,500. Many projects in this category are standard repairs that require moderate effort and materials, with fewer reaching the upper end of this range.

Full Replacement - Replacing an entire porch slab can cost from $2,000 to $4,500,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Larger or more intricate replacements are less common but can push costs higher, especially if additional structural work is needed.

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ex porch slab repairs or custom designs can exceed $5,000, particularly when involving reinforced concrete or decorative finishes. These projects are less frequent and typically involve detailed planning and specialized craftsmanship from local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es porch slab damage? Porch slabs can be damaged by soil movement, freeze-thaw cycles, or heavy loads that lead to cracking and settling.

How can porch slab cracks be repaired? Local contractors typically use methods like mudjacking, slab lifting, or concrete patching to fix cracks and restore stability.

Is uneven porch slabs a safety concern? Yes, uneven slabs can create tripping hazards and may require leveling or replacement by experienced service providers.

What are common signs that porch slabs need repair? Visible cracking, sinking edges, or uneven surfaces are indicators that professional repair services may be needed.

How do professionals prepare for porch slab repair? They assess the damage, determine the best repair method, and ensure proper surface preparation for effective results.
